One of the primary benefits of taking piano lessons as an older adult is the cognitive stimulation that learning a new skill provides Learning to play the piano requires hand-eye coordination, fine motor skills, and the ability to read music – all of which can help keep your brain sharp and improve your memory Studies have shown that older adults who engage in regular cognitive activities, such as playing a musical instrument, have a lower risk of developing cognitive decline and dementia.

In addition to the cognitive benefits, playing the piano can also be a great form of stress relief and emotional expression Music has the ability to evoke powerful emotions and can provide a therapeutic outlet for feelings of stress, anxiety, or sadness Learning to play the piano can be a creative and fulfilling way to express yourself and connect with others through music.

Many instructors offer flexible scheduling and lesson plans that can be customized to fit your needs and goals You may also want to consider reaching out to local retirement communities or senior centers, as they may offer group piano lessons or other musical activities specifically for older adults.

In addition to traditional in-person lessons, many instructors now offer online piano lessons for older adults Online lessons can be a convenient and flexible option for older learners who may have limited mobility or transportation options With online lessons, you can learn to play the piano from the comfort of your own home, on your own schedule.
